Goodnotes turns complexity into clarity. Goodnotes 6 - Notes Reimagined. Goodnotes is a powerful note-taking app that combines a natural handwriting experience with powerful AI-enabled digital capabilities. Whether you’re taking notes, brainstorming, or planning, Goodnotes empowers you to do your best thinking and creating. Goodnotes is used by more than 24 million users worldwide and was named Apple's 2022 iPad App of the Year.

Our Goodnotes Scholarship winner has officially started her place at National Mathematics and Science College. This year, Goodnotes offered a generous, 50% boarding scholarship to young learners all over the world. The candidates needed to demonstrate that they are focussed on STEM subjects and that they are determined to overcome challenges along the way. This was a vigorous process, and it was incredibly difficult to select a winner. However, Chinemerem A. was clearly able to demonstrate her passion for STEM along with a commitment to studying a STEM subject at university. She was enthusiastic about her experiences in this field in the past and is determined to make a difference in the world. What better place for her to accomplish this dream than at the National Mathematics and Science College, which is perhaps the most highly regarded STEM specialist school in the UK. We asked Chinemerem a few questions about her experience and her expectations: Please could you tell me about your schooling experience to date? I went to Northampton School for Girls prior to NatMatSci. Although it wasn’t STEM focused, the school did provide opportunities for the students to participate. Unlike many of the schools in Northampton, they provided a range of opportunities and encouraged us to become more interested in STEM related subjects. My science and math teachers were mostly females, who always made the effort to make lessons interesting and fun. Additionally, they demonstrated that women can be successful in STEM, which helped my views on what I could do in science shift. What made you a great candidate for this scholarship? I am incredibly passionate about STEM, which I feel I conveyed clearly both in the application and the interview. Moreover, I believe that I was able to demonstrate my willingness to work towards my goals through the STEM programmes I participated in throughout my time in secondary school. Finally, I also think that I was able to be open-minded about my experiences, which is very useful in STEM. What interests you most about STEM? I’ve been interested in science from a young age. Learning how even the smallest things could have such intricate existences made me see the world at large, and helped me understand it better. This still applies to me now - I feel that STEM still helps me in ways I never would have imagined it would have before. For instance, I found that many principles in computer science can be applied in subjects such as art, English, and even PE! By applying my base knowledge in those subjects, I was able to improve in them in a way I wouldn’t have been able to do without it.
